Transaction 66a5580b8b22315f061dfa54bc963abba4ab8e80727ed3697f093b8a24fe6b32
1 Input
1 Output
-
66a5580b8b22315f061dfa54bc963abba4ab8e80727ed3697f093b8a24fe6b32:0
- value
- 10185806
- script pubkey
- OP_0 OP_PUSHBYTES_32 829216685dfae12f1dcb83793f56b17dc5db4e5fb07cb578508823321e8ab1c6
- address
- bc1qs2fpv6zaltsj78wtsdun74430hzaknjlkp7t27zs3q3ny852k8rq7snxlz